Default Garden Office Building? What do you recommend?

A few years ago (1999) I has something similar made - but 8 x 6 feet
only FYI. Wooden shed, extra wide door (for tables to get in and
out), insulated. Had a frost free base laid (bricks and concreete
AIUI!), shed went on that. Paid a sparky to puit in the leccy, then
BT put in a phone line. It can be chilly in the winter - but I first
had a electric radiator on a timer in there to keep the damp/cold at
bay (and believe me in 8 x 6 feet it didn't take long for it to be
swealtering! Now I have several systems running 24 x 7 I don;t bother
with the heater as the systems create enough heat top prevent damp in
the paperwork. A small fan heater does for if I get chilly.

Total cost about a grand - but its really a case of how long is a
piece of string. The insulation is (for me) a must, otherwose all you
have is a woodern shell against the elements. Security isn;t too big
a deal as the only system that is "KEY" and worth £££ is my laptop
which lives in the house with me. You could make of security what you
will of course - door bolt, internal hinge bolts - no windows would be
best of course ! Then you could use wall brackets etc to tether
equipment to - a client of mine has steel cages that are fixed to the
floor within which systems are locked and you could probably finf
something similar if you had a concrret base to afix them to.

As for size you might get away with smaller than you think - don;t
forget you have 5-6 feet of height to play with also. A smaller room
will heat easier (maybe the systems will be enough on their own) and
of course be cheaper to buy. you'd be surprised for instance how much
you can fit in 8x6 feet - I've a small network running with a desk and
a bookshelf/filing shelf easily, with a small window.
